Terrorists attacked an Armoured Unit in Samba in the morning of 26 September. The Second-in-Command (2IC) Lt Col Bikramjeet Singh was killed and the Commanding Officer Colonel Avin Uthaiya received bullet injuries. There was another attack on a police station at Kathua. At least twelve people were killed and four injured in the twin terror attacks. The usual suspect is the Lashkar-e-Taiba (LeT), rather its latest ruse, Shohada Brigade. These attacks were in the region,  located in proximity to the International Boundary (IB), not the least disputed. Simultaneously, from across the Line of Control (LoC) there was brazen infiltration bid in the Keran Sector by at least 30 Pakistan-based militants of which a dozen were eliminated by the Indian Army.

Negligible Peace Constituency

The decision-makers in India, complicit with incorrigible segment of commentators and media establishment were at pains to distinguish between ‘Nawaz Sharif’, the secular political and democratic ‘face of Pakistan’, and the military-intelligence establishment. They with great elan suggested that the two were at cross purposes. Nawaz Sharif, they maintained was part of the constituency desperate for peace. The latest attacks they construed were to derail the ‘peace process’. Nothing could be farther from truth. There is insignificant peace constituency left in Pakistan.

The support provided by the terror outfit ‘Lashkar-e-Jhangvi’ (LeJ) to Nawaz Sharif in the recent elections is common knowledge. It is also documented that Nawaz Sharif’s brother Shahbaz Sharif, the Chief Minister of Punjab, has provided Rs.61 million budget allocation to Hafiz Saeed in the current fiscal. The Punjab Govt also provided Rs.350 million grant-in-aid to ‘Markaz-e-Taiba’ of Hafiz Saeed’s Jamaat-ul-Dawa (JuD) for setting-up ‘Knowledge Park’. The JuD center, which was located at Murdike on outskirts of Lahore, was taken over by the Punjab government shortly after UN Security Council designated JuD a front of the LeT in the wake of Mumbai attacks. In fact, the police in Punjab let all the LeT leaders escape arrest and only a year later the Shahbaz government approved a grant  one million  US dollars to LeT.

Imran Khan’s Tehreek-i-Insaf not only collaborated with jihadi elements in run-up to the elections but runs the government in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a with Jamaat-e-Islami. The government has restored the violent jihadi content in the school text books in the province, which was removed by the Awami National Party (ANP), when it came to power in 2008.

The stark reality therefore in Pakistan is that apart from the military-establishment, nearly all mainstream political forces are in truck with the jihadi outfits.

In Pakistan, there could be internal differences between the political class and the military on power sharing, but there is near complete unanimity with regard to jihad and its anti-India objectives. Jihadi Subversion of Universities

The Punjab province of Pakistan is now emerging as the new epicenter and base of Jihadis. Lahore, as per some reports, is now the hub of al Qaeda in the country. A communication center of the al Qaeda was busted in Lahore in August this year (read ‘Campus Terror’ by Khalid Ahmed, Indian Express, 27 September 2013). This center operating in the name of ‘International Technical Hub’ was receiving signals from Afghanistan. At least, half a dozen terrorists including women were arrested.

The  Arab funded International Islamic University, Islamabad is the key the ideological nerve-center of global jihad. In fact the father of ‘global jihad’ and  the mentor of Osama bin Laden , the Palestinian, Abdullah Azam taught in this university. The universities in Pakistan, as per Khalid Ahmed, are under complete sway of Islamic Jamaat Taliba (IJT), the student wing of JeI. The Lahore University of Engineering and Technology, where Hafiz Saeed served as a lecturer, is the most formidable stronghold of IJT. The Vice-Chancellor of Punjab University has lamented that the hostels in the university are infested with terrorists, but such is the influence of the IJT with the dispensation that nothing much can be done. Teachers betraying liberal outlook are routinely beaten up by the IJT cadres. The IJT and the JeI members have been providing shelter to al Qaeda elements.

It may be recalled that Sheikh Mohammad, one of the planners of 9/11, was arrested from women’s wing leader of JeI in Rawalpindi. Abu Zubayadah, a Saudi Arabian citizen belonging to the al Qaeda, was arrested in Faisalabad from a shelter given by Hafiz Saeed.

Together Hafiz Saeed’s JuD and the JeI command overwhelming influence on the youth of the country. All shades of jihadi organizations in Punjab, Taliban–Punjabinon-Punjabis as per Mr Khalid,are sustained by Al-Zawahiri’s Arab money, and muscle and purse of JuD. Hafiz Saeed is known for his spiritual links to the founder of al Qaeda, Abdullah Azam.

Punjab: New Global Jihad Epicenter

In a shift from Af-Pak region,the Punjab province of Pakistan is being nurtured by the jihadis of all hues as the base for the fresh jihad to be launched against the Afghan regime and its 3,50,000 strong new Afghan Army for takeover of Afghanistan. The province has been consciously chosen, as the Pashtuns in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a and Waziristan continue to be in an imbalanced state and the men who constituted the mainstay in the war against Soviet Union and later in support of Taliban regime, have suffered considerable attrition. Punjab province therefore is the new recruiting ground and jihadi hub.

Al-Zawahiri, the present head of al Qaeda, as per some reports, is located in the Punjab province, somewhere in the outskirts of Lahore. The attack in shopping mall in Nairobi,in which nearly 72 people were killed and more than 175 injured, by Al-Shabab group,( affiliate of al Qaeda) and the attack in a Church in Peshawar (72 killed) carried similar signatures as the targets were specifically non-Muslims. There are many Pakistanis apart from Afghans, Iraqis, Yemenese  as well as Europeans in the ranks of Al Shabab. The overall direction is provided by Al-Zawahri.

The audacity of attacks witnessed recently, as per some analysts, suggests a resurgent sense of triumphalism amongst the jihadi groups because of the envisaged withdrawal of the US troops from Afghanistan. The same sense of invincibility was palpable in the jihadi discourse following the withdrawal of Soviet troops from Afghanistan. Entire India is the Target

Calls made from ten different states including Kerala, Andhra Pradesh and Maharashtra indicate the phenomenon of Indian jihadi volunteers being sent for training with Taliban and al Qaeda. The Popular Front of India (PFI), a South India based organization was reportedly formed at the behest of al Qaeda and LeT. Two years back, four trained PFI cadres were apprehended in Kupwara in J&K. Another Indian from Tamilnaidu Mohammad Niaz Abdul Rashid accused of creating a group for ‘armed jihad’ told his French interrogators that he was part of PFI and was in contact with jihadis in Pakistan. Intriguingly, the PFI  is still not a proscribed organization in India.

The proxy war soldiers and facilitators in India are spread all over the country. The jihadi threat looms all over.
